WinGet Configuration enables developers to set up complete Windows development environments using declarative YAML files executed with a single command. Unlike simple package lists from winget import/export, configuration files can install packages, enable Windows settings like Developer Mode, install Visual Studio workloads,
•8m read time• From devblogs.microsoft.com
Table of contents
What is WinGet Configuration? Copy linkGetting started Copy linkHow is this different from WinGet import/export? Copy linkYour first configuration file Copy linkAdding Windows settings Copy linkUsing assertions for requirements Copy linkDependencies between resources Copy linkUsing GitHub Copilot CLI to generate configs Copy linkThe export command: Reverse-engineer your setup Copy linkStore configs in your repos Copy linkMy configuration file Copy linkCheers! Copy linkSort: